做web前端需要具备哪些素质

不及物动词 其他 16

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    做web前端需要具备以下素质:

    1. 扎实的HTML、CSS和JavaScript基础:作为web前端开发的基础,掌握HTML(超文本标记语言)、CSS(层叠样式表)和JavaScript等 web技术是必不可少的。HTML用于构建网页结构,CSS用于美化页面样式,JavaScript用于实现动态交互效果。

    2. 良好的设计感和美学功底:web前端开发不仅要关注技术实现,还要注重页面的设计和美感。一个好的前端开发人员应该具备良好的设计感和美学功底,能够根据需求进行页面布局和设计,使用户体验更加友好和舒适。

    3. 良好的问题解决能力:web前端开发中常常遇到各种问题和 bug,一个优秀的前端开发人员应该具备良好的问题解决能力。能够独立分析和解决问题,查找文档和资源,能够快速定位并修复bug,提高开发效率。

    4. 学习能力和持续学习的意识:web前端技术更新换代迅速,一个优秀的前端开发人员应该具备良好的学习能力和持续学习的意识。能够不断跟进最新的web前端技术,学习新的开发框架和工具,提高自己的技术水平。

    5. 良好的团队合作能力:web前端开发往往是多人协作进行的,一个优秀的前端开发人员应该具备良好的团队合作能力。能够与UI设计师、后端开发人员等其他角色进行有效的沟通和协作,共同完成项目的开发工作。

    6. 对用户体验的关注和理解:用户体验是web前端开发的重要考量因素,一个优秀的前端开发人员应该对用户体验有足够的关注和理解。能够从用户的角度思考问题,合理优化页面操作和交互方式,提高用户的满意度。

    7. 良好的沟通表达能力:web前端开发往往需要与产品经理、项目经理等非技术角色进行沟通,一个优秀的前端开发人员应该具备良好的沟通表达能力。能够清晰准确地表达自己的想法和意见,与非技术人员进行有效的沟通和协商。

    总结起来,做web前端需要具备扎实的技术基础、良好的设计感和美学功底、问题解决能力、学习能力和持续学习的意识、团队合作能力、对用户体验的关注和理解,以及良好的沟通表达能力等素质。只有具备这些素质,才能成为一名优秀的web前端开发人员。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    作为一个Web前端开发人员,你需要具备以下几个素质:

    1.前端技术知识:作为前端开发人员,你需要掌握HTML、CSS和JavaScript等前端技术的基础知识。HTML用于搭建网页结构,CSS用于设计网页样式,JavaScript用于实现网页交互和动态效果。你需要熟练掌握这些技术,并不断学习和掌握新的前端技术,如React、Vue等。

    2.设计能力:作为前端开发人员,你需要有一定的设计能力,能够根据设计师提供的设计稿将网页转化为代码。你需要了解并掌握网页的排版、颜色搭配、素材选择等设计原则,以及一些设计工具如Photoshop、Sketch等。

    3.团队合作能力:在现代的Web开发中,往往是由一个开发团队共同完成一个项目。作为前端开发人员,你需要与项目经理、设计师、后端开发人员等人员密切合作,共同完成项目。你需要善于沟通、交流,并能够与其他人员协调工作。

    4.解决问题能力:前端开发中,会经常遇到各种各样的问题,如浏览器兼容性问题、代码Bug等。作为前端开发人员,你需要具备解决问题的能力,能够快速定位问题并找到解决方案。你需要善于使用工具和资源,如浏览器的开发者工具、控制台等,来帮助你进行问题的诊断和解决。

    5.持续学习能力:Web前端技术在不断发展,新的技术和框架层出不穷。作为前端开发人员,你需要保持持续学习的态度,不断学习新的技术和工具,跟上行业的发展趋势。只有不断学习和提高自己,才能在竞争激烈的前端领域中保持竞争力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要成为一名优秀的Web前端工程师,需要具备以下素质:

    1. 扎实的HTML/CSS基础知识:HTML是网页的结构化语言,CSS用来为网页添加样式。前端工程师需要熟悉HTML标签的使用,了解各种CSS属性和选择器的作用,掌握常见的布局技巧。

    2. JavaScript编程能力:JavaScript是前端开发中最重要的编程语言之一,通过JavaScript可以实现丰富的交互效果和动态功能。前端工程师需要掌握JavaScript的基本语法、对象、DOM操作、事件处理等知识,并具备良好的编程逻辑能力。

    3. 跨浏览器兼容性处理能力:不同的浏览器对网页的解析和渲染存在差异,前端工程师需要了解各类浏览器的特点,编写兼容多个浏览器的代码。

    4. 前端框架和工具的使用能力:掌握一种或多种主流的前端框架(如React、Vue.js、Angular等)可以提高开发效率,了解版本控制工具(如Git)等也是前端工程师必备的技能。

    5. UI/UX设计理念:要使网页具有良好的用户体验,前端工程师需要了解用户界面设计原则,懂得如何设计简洁、直观、易用的页面。

    6. 前端性能优化技巧:对于大型网页或应用,前端性能优化是一个重要的考虑因素,前端工程师需要了解一些性能优化的技巧,如减少HTTP请求、压缩资源、使用缓存等。

    7. 团队协作能力:前端工程师通常需要与设计师、后端工程师等协同工作,需要具备良好的沟通能力和团队合作精神。

    最后,作为一名优秀的前端工程师,持续学习和保持对新技术的敏感度也非常重要。IT行业更新速度快,前端领域也不例外,不断学习新的技术和工具,保持与行业同步,才能不断提高自己的技能水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部